Eine neue Beta Version des Amiga Emulators WinUAE wurde veröffentlicht.


A new beta version of the Amiga emulator WinUAE has been released.

Zitat:
Beta 12:
  • AGA border sprite feature emulation is now also cycle-exact. Similar update to borderblank was done in 2.5.0. For example it was possible that sprites were hidden when border sprite bit was set and zero bit planes enabled. (Noticed when doing some unrelated real hardware limit tests)
  • Black frame insertion was incorrectly used (if enabled) in <100Hz fastest possible CPU modes.
  • Horizontal blanking rewritten, should be more accurate now, programmed display modes only.
  • Display emulation tweak, Super72 sprite display corruption is gone.
  • Fixed bug introduced in b5, blitter emulation ignored DMA off state in cycle exact mode.
  • Emulate DIV divide by zero undocumented flags when CPU >=68020. So far 68020 and 68060 tested and confirmed. Odyssey / Alcatraz and 68020+ CPU does not anymore get stuck in part where spaceship flies above ground.
  • CPU halted state didn´t disable CPU interrupts.

Beta 11:
  • Blank left and right border if programmed mode and part of original borders would be outside of programmed hsync start and end period.
  • Address error exception always started debugger, forgotten debug option disabled.
  • Added Ts debugger command, list all exec residents.
  • Restoring state file with harddrives crashed in some situations. (broke with previous filesystem updates)
  • CD32 TOC entries were transmitted too quickly due to missing check, correct speed would have been one entry per CD frame (75/sec), not one entry per scanline. CD command buffer overflowed and driver detected CD as broken if CD had enough tracks. Old bug, was mostly invisible until 2.5.0 Universe TOC fix. (Super Street Fighter II Turbo and others CDs with lots of tracks)
  • IDE emulation ignored optional forced physical cylinder number setting in config file.
  • Both hires and superhires bits in BPLCON0 set: superhires mode active.
  • 100Hz+ black frame insertion is now optional, setting in Misc panel. (Still D3D/low latency vsync only)
  • GamePorts panel test/remap improved
    - Implemented custom event add option. Select event from select box and click "Add", then press any button/key/etc to map it.
    - Added event will be automatically removed if it does not have any mapped events (Works differently than normal events)
    - Loading config file that has GamePorts panel custom added events using older version is not supported.
